The Gonzalez family has three children on summer break they want to an amusement park they bought three child tickets for $18.50

and two adult tickets if they spent a total of $104.50 how much was the price of each adult ticket

Answer:

Each adult ticket was $43

Step-by-step explanation:

2x+18.5 = 104.5

Simplify

2x = 86

x = $43

A political candidate has asked you to conduct a poll to determine what percentage of people support him. If the candidate only
lara31 [8.8K]

Answer:

900

Step-by-step explanation:

Margin of error = critical value × standard error

The margin of error is given to be 0.05.

At 99.5% confidence, the critical value is z = 3.

The standard error for a proportion is √(pq/n).  Since p is not given, we will assume p = 0.5.

0.05 = 3 √(0.5 × 0.5 / n)

n = 900

Find the area of the region enclosed by x(t)=t^2-2t, y(t)=sqrt(t), and the y-axis. ...?
zaharov [31]
First find the the value of t where the curve intersects the Y-axis. This is when x = 0. 

x = t^2 - 2t = 0 = t(t - 2) 


So t= 0 and t = 2 

dA = (0 - x)*dy .... Since the curve has negative x in this region 

y = SQRT(t) and dy = [(1/2)/SQRT(t)]dt 

dA = [2t - t^2][(1/2)/SQRT(t)]dt 

dA = [t^(1/2) - (1/2)t^(3/2)]dt 


Integrate to get: A = (2/3)t^(3/2) - (1/5)t^(5/2) 


Now evaluate from t= 0 to t = 2. 


Area = [(2/3)2^(3/2) - (1/5)2^(5/2)] - [0]
